Table of Contents
In a mobile testing flow, there are lots of factors having influence on quality of products. So let’s find it down.
1. Mobile testing flow-App installing
・ Can the app be installed on your device?
・ What happens when the app is installed (the device runs out of battery, loses network, ..)
2. Mobile testing flow-Device memory
・ App takes up a lot of device memory?
・ What happens if you install the app when full memory?
3. Mobile testing flow-Display
・ Check vertical and horizontal screen
・ Check actions, zoom in/out (all actions)
・ Check the interface is not cut
・ Check to see if objects overlap
・ Check to see the loading icon appears where needed or not
・ Characters should not move away from certain screens/ areas
・ Check to enable or disable images / icons and buttons
・ Check the screen title
・ Check the message title, description description, label (textbox title) match or not
・ Check if the focus position is set to the first field or the first control when the screen loads.
・ Display font (color, size …)
・ Scroll effects, smooth page transition
・ The data saved when the window is closed, …
4. Mobile testing flow-Function
・ Ensure the functions included in the design work well
・ Test out-of-stream functions
・ Click, swipe, otuch, scroll … fast to detect errors
・ Redirects from links in apps or social links (g・, facebook …)
・ Get data from the server while in background running, screen lock or listen
・ Check data synchronization when logging in to multiple devices (desktop, tablet, mobile)
・ Test camera if available in the application, (take photos, store …)
・ Content and images display well when sharing on Google, facebook …or phones with facebook and applications installed, and without those applications.
・ Notification from apps like updates, reminders …
・ On / Off sound occur error
・ Time on app, server, ..
・ Change the time on the Device
・ Shutdown network suddenly while using the app
・ Rotate the screen while using the app
・ Check app vibration if available
・ Check if using the app for a long time may cause heat
・ Check other actions interfering while using the app: making calls, texting, alarms, …
・ Attention to test for System Crash / Force Close cases
5. Mobile testing flow-Update new version
・ Check if an updated version available while using the app
・ Check if data loss when updating to a new version
For more information about Testing services, please contact us
Lotus Quality Assurance (LQA)
Tel: (+84) 24-6660-7474